Digimon Story: Cyber Sleuth to get a physical release in certain EU countries
Digimon Story: Cyber Sleuth, the hugely anticipated Digimon JRPG, is going to get a retail release on PS4 in the United Kingdom, Germany and Italy.
The Vita version will still be digital only but with the relatively small market on Vita, this should come as no surprise. Suzuhito Yasuda, the artist behind the light novel illustrations for many series’ including Durarara!! and the Devil Survivor games, worked on Cyber Sleuth and helped to bring the characters to life. Digimon Story: Cyber Sleuth is releasing on PS4 and Vita early next year in Europe and North America, and it looks as if it’ll be worth the wait.
